Driver with cast on leg loses control of car, injuring 4 including a baby

1 moderately hurt; police said to believe driver was trying to work pedals with left foot when he crashed in Rishon Lezion; he’s extricated from vehicle and taken for questioning

Four people were injured on Monday after a vehicle crashed into a window at a nursing home in Rishon Lezion.

The suspect, a 60-year-old resident of the city, was driving with a plaster cast on his right leg, and was trying to control the gas and brake pedals using his left foot, but he lost control, according to Hebrew-language reports.

The elder care facility was set some way back from the road. The vehicle drove across a pedestrian plaza before hitting the building and coming to a stop.

A 60-year-old woman was moderately injured and three others, including an 8-month-old baby, suffered light injuries.

According to Channel 12 news, the driver was initially trapped in the vehicle and had to be released by emergency services.

He was then taken by police for questioning.
